The Federal Government has declared Monday, October 3, 2022, as a public holiday to mark the nation’s 62nd Independence anniversary celebration. The announcement was made in a statement issued on Wednesday, September 28, 2022, by the Minister of Interior, Rauf Aregbesola, signed by the Ministry’s Permanent Secretary, Shuaib Belgore. NCC-CSIRT urges Firmware update after Lenovo found Vulnerabilities in own products
Equipment manufacturer, Lenovo, has disclosed several vendor vulnerabilities in some of its products, which it said could lead to information disclosure, privilege escalation, and denial of service. The vulnerabilities primarily affected Lenovo Products (Desktop, Desktop-All in One, Hyperscale, Lenovo Notebook, Smart Office, Storage, ThinkAgile, ThinkPad, ThinkServer, ThinkStation, and ThinkSystem). The Nigerian Communications Commission’s Computer Security Incident Response Team (NCC-CSIRT), in its recent advisory, rated the probability of the vulnerability as high with an equally high damage potential. Lawan loses as court affirms Machina as Yobe North APC senatorial candidate
A Federal High Court sitting in Damaturu has affirmed Bashir Sheriff Machina as the All Progressives Congress’ (APC) senatorial candidate for Yobe North. Justice Fadima Aminu in her ruling on Wednesday, September 28, 2022, ordered the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to immediately publish Machina’s name as the ruling party’s candidate in the district’s 2023 National Assembly election. The judge also said Bashir Sheriff Machina was duly elected senatorial candidate for APC, consequently upholding the May 28 primary election of the party that was also certified by INEC.…

Oyetola assents Ilesa University Establishment Law …as implementation committee begins compositional structures
The Osun Governor, Adegboyega Oyetola, on Tuesday assented the Law seeking to upgrade the Osun State College of Education, Ilesa to a full-fleged University. The Governor’s assent followed the successful passage of the Executive Bill into Law by the Osun House of Assembly in August this year. IIP-SARS submits final report to NHRC, tasks FG …. As Ojukwu optimistic on Implementation
The Independent Investigation Panel on Human Rights Violations by the defunct SARS and other units of the Nigerian Police (IIP-SARS) on Tuesday presented its report to the National Human Rights Commission after the payment of N438 million to 100 victims in the last 10 months.
